Subject: Approval of Contract with State'Department of Health Services to implement
Drinking Water Sources Assessment and Protection Pro (DSAP)
Specific Request(s)or Recommendation(s)and Background and Justification - -
� $�3f$i3Y9:
Approve and authorize the Health Services Director,or hus designee(Kenneth C. tuart)to execute on behaff of the
County a contract ct t een Contra Costa County for it's Contra eta Health Services Department,Contra Costa
Environmental Health 13ivision as Local Fire Agency(LPA)and the State Department of Health Services,
Pram Support Branch,effective'June 1, 1999 throargh Jim 30,2002,to educt source mater assessaxebts for public
drinking water sources under LPA junsdiction in coordination with the California ung Water Sources Assessment
and Protection Program(DWSAP).
Barou €:
The I 9S6 Amendments to the Federal Sale Drihicing Mater Act(SDWA)established a new program to protect gra
and'surface waters that supply the drinking water of public water systems. Under SDWA,each State was required to
prepare a Source'mater Assessment and,Protection Program(SWAP)and submit it to the L rated States Environmental
Protection_Agency for apprmal.
cif via,throe the State Department of Health Services'Division ofDrinking Water and Emmmental
Management,has submitted a program and obtained approval for the proms faun the EPA. The approv=ed program is
to be completed during the nod three yews,with a completion.date of June 34,2002. AsLPA,Comm Costa
Environmental Health has the option of entering into the contrast to conduct the D SAP on the 122 ground and
sures water systems under its regulatory authority air delegate this authority to the State Department of Health
Setvice& Congress and the EPA have provided fry for the programs,and the LPAs conducting the Pr -will
receive$325.00 per source. 'haus,Contra Costa Environmental Health will receive$3 9,650.€0 over the#. t yeaa terra
Of the contract.
To implement the DWSAP Progmm,Contra Costa Environmental Health will l e to complete the following
components for each of the 122 eater systems it regulates:
Location of Dnukmg Water Source
Delineation of Source Area and Protection Zona
DririkingWater Physio Bonier Effectiveness Chemist
Inventory of possible Coen Activities
1ninerabdity Rxddng
Assemnent? p
Cor ietion of Assessment and Summary �
Public Notification

it is anticipated that the S39,650.00($325. 310 will not provide full cost revery for the program. Each
rebated small water system pays an annual fee,and the She Department of Health Services has aid tit the
DWSAP=be used as part of our annual inspection and permit activities. With these two ftmding sources combined,
it is anticipated that the DWSAP can be completed without additional staff and without a new county cost.
bra ID—Ir
If the contact were not approved,the DWSAP program would have to be completed by the State Department of Health
Services,Division of Drigg Aster(D17 D. I'm DDW staff have indicated that the assessment would be conducted
from ftir Berkeley office. The DDW staff have indicated that these assessments would utilim very conservative
Ssmrm. Protection Vis,which could result in denying water analyses waivers to the Srnall'Water System
owners. The owners would then have to pay additional annual cis for the analyses,and larger protection zones could
unpact fatter land uses around the eater sources.
